Lake Michigan & Inland Lake Fishing
Anglers from all over know that Ludington is the #1 salmon port on Lake Michigan. Numerous Ludington charter captains have years of experience on the big lake and are eager to take you on a fishing excursion. Hamlin Lake is full of northern pike, bass, perch, and bluegill--or ice fish in the winter for panfish and walleye. There's also great fishing in nearby Pere Marquette Lake and the Pere Marquette River.Ludington State Park
Midwest Living magazine voted the Ludington State Park the #1 state park in the Midwest, with seven miles of Lake Michigan shoreline. Enjoy camping, boating, fishing, swimming--or hike on one of eight marked trails that wind through the park and bring you face to face with nature's beauty. Two highlights of the Ludington State Park are the Hamlin Lake Dam and the Big Sable Point Lighthouse. While you're at the Lake Michigan Beach be sure to visit the Beach House for concessions and a great view...or head over to Hamlin Beach and rent a canoe, kayak, paddleboard or paddle boat for hours of fun.
S.S. Badger Carferry
Ludington is the home port of the largest carferry to sail the Great Lakes. The S.S. Badger carferry makes its voyage from Ludington to Manitowoc, Wisconsin mid-May to mid-October. This 410' ship carries up to 620 passengers and 180 vehicles. Onboard you can play Badger Bingo, watch a movie, shop, or enjoy a meal in one of their two restaurants. Kid's activities include a video arcade, coloring contests, and playroom. The best part of the journey is sitting on deck and enjoying the view--including spectacular sunsets. The S.S.
